Plate 29 of the 1925 Bromley Atlas for Brighton covers Harvard University's Allston campus, an area roughly bounded by the Charles River and North Harvard Street. The original map is approximately 33 inches wide and 23 inches tall. The colors have been hand-brushed rather than printed. (Brick or stone buildings are red, wooden framed buildings are yellow, iron framed buildings are blue, and streets accepted by the city are colored in.) |
